Curtain call at Market Place

ITS been a long time coming, but The Market Place Theatre in Armagh has released its Spring 2022 season programme, offering theatre goers something to finally look forward to.

Here’s just a glimpse of some of the varied and exciting entertainment on offer.

After the last two years, we all need a laugh, and The Market Place can deliver just that. There’s a wealth of comedy on offer over the coming months, from the likes of County Down’s finest, Patrick Kielty; ‘The Outright King’ of live comedy, Jason Byrne; Irish cult comedy hero Owen Colgan and many more, all of whom will be cramming two years of material into one show, and bringing laughter back to the aisles.

Advertisement

Maybe you’ve missed the invigorating sound of live music. Get back in the groove with the finest singers and songwriters in the business. Taking to the stage will be the spectacular and ever-popular Ronnie Greer Blues Band; Scotland’s greatest living female voice, Eddi Reader; and the rocking Pat McManus Band.

You can also catch some of the finest tribute bands and artists over the coming months, from Celtic Soul, who effortlessly recreate the sounds of our very own Van Morrison, to Lionel, a breathtaking tribute to the music of Lionel Richie, or The Roy Orbison Story, where you’ll feel like you’re in the company of The Man In Black himself.

If classical music is more your style, sit back and relax with the delightful sounds of The Sitkovetsky Trio, or enjoy a scintillating evening of much-loved opera arias, duets and ensembles with Ulster Touring Opera. Or catch one of the amazing recitals with the talented pianist Cahal Masterson, trumpeter Stephen Murphy, and the spectacular pianist Michael McHale.

Drama buffs will be well catered for. Back on stage are Bruiser Theatre Company who will present Owen McCafferty’s renowned play ‘Mojo Mickybo’, while ‘The Man Who Left The Titanic’ will take on the morals of those on board the doomed liner. Why not try some interactive drama and see if you can solve the crime in ‘Solve-Along-A-Murder-She-Wrote’, a new thoroughly enjoyable theatre experience.

Don’t forget The Market Place also offers a superb range of interactive workshops for adults and children, but be quick, because these are sure to be as popular as ever, and tickets won’t hang around for long.
